Trends Defining Charlotte Beauty
Several trends shape how residents shop for cosmetics. Inclusivity remains a top priority, with shoppers expecting broad shade ranges and products designed for diverse skin types. Clean beauty continues to rise, driving demand for transparent ingredient lists and skin-nourishing formulas.
The line between skincare and makeup is increasingly blurred, with hybrid products like tinted moisturizers and serum foundations gaining popularity. Social media also plays a major role, as viral tutorials and reviews influence purchasing decisions and introduce shoppers to emerging brands quickly.
